The Drolet HT-3000

The Drolet HT-3000 wood-burning fireplace is more than a simple stove. It's a statement piece that will elevate the appearance of your home. The sleek, modern design of this stove combines both function and form. It features a large glass viewing window that offers stunning views of the roaring flame. This stunning design lets the warm flickering glow to suffuse your living space, creating a warm and inviting ambience.

This wood stove is designed to warm areas of up to 2700 square feet and features a spacious firebox which can hold up to 60 pounds of wood. The low emissions and long burn times make this a reliable heating option that is in line with your environmental concerns. The HT-3000 is the ideal wood stove for heating your entire home, as it provides ample warmth to your entire home without any compromise in comfort or efficiency.

This wood-burning stove is easy to set up and comes with a simple venting system that can be connected to any standard exhaust pipe. It is recommended that an expert install this stove to ensure safety and compliance with local regulations. However, some experienced DIY enthusiasts may be able to complete the installation themselves. The HT-3000 has a variety of options including a thermodisc a fire screen and a blower.

The iStove

The iStove is a modern wood burning stove outdoor that combines a variety of functions into one unit. It can be used to heat a tent during camping, cook food and even dry clothes using low heat. It has a chimney that carries smoke away from the tent. This makes it safe and comfortable to use in outdoor settings. It is light and compact, making it simple to store and carry during camping trips.

If you're looking for a new wood-burning stove it is important to think about your personal needs and preferences. The size of the space you're planning to heat, the power output and efficiency rating, as well as your preferred design style are just a few of the factors that can help determine which stove is best for you.



There are a variety of stoves, including free-standing models as well as ones which can be used in fireplaces already installed. Some can even be used for heating saunas, hot tubs and boilers! It's important to choose one that meets your needs and budget. Ask a professional or visit the showroom if aren't sure which stove to buy.

It's safe to use a well-made stove in most outdoor conditions. However it's a good idea to consult the local authorities to determine whether there are any restrictions regarding the use of open flames. Use only safe fire starters and never let your stove go unattended, regardless of whether you're setting up the stove in your backyard or on a camping trip. It's also a good idea, in case of emergency to have an emergency fire extinguisher that you can carry on the go.
